Human brains and AI are both amazing in their own ways, but they excel in different areas. Here's a breakdown of some key differences:
Human Brain
Strengths:
Creativity and imagination: We can come up with new ideas and solutions.
Common sense and reasoning: We can apply knowledge to new situations and understand cause and effect.
Social intelligence: We can understand and respond to emotions, build relationships, and cooperate.
Adaptability: We can learn from experience and adjust to new situations.
Weaknesses:
Slow processing: We take time to think and learn.
Susceptible to biases and emotions: Our judgment can be clouded by feelings.
Limited memory capacity: We can forget things over time.
AI
Strengths:
Speed and accuracy: AI can process information and complete tasks much faster than humans.
Data analysis: AI can identify patterns and trends in massive datasets that humans might miss.
Tireless performance: AI can work continuously without getting tired or needing breaks.
Weaknesses:

Lacks common sense and reasoning: AI struggles with tasks that require understanding the real world or applying knowledge in new ways.
Limited creativity: AI is good at following instructions and completing specific tasks, but it's not good at coming up with new ideas.
Reliant on data: The quality of AI output depends on the quality of the data it's trained on.
Overall, the goal isn't to replace human intelligence with AI. Instead, they can complement each other. AI can handle repetitive tasks and data analysis, freeing humans to focus on creative problem-solving and social interaction.
